Transaction 08dc151acdc6373800690a4b834c2cb986c5c956f6e698014bff9032ee8fa521
1 Input
2 Outputs
- 08dc151acdc6373800690a4b834c2cb986c5c956f6e698014bff9032ee8fa521:0
- 08dc151acdc6373800690a4b834c2cb986c5c956f6e698014bff9032ee8fa521:1
value 1007626591
address 1E7poMN4eZG8haX4fzkoGqhy2ENvTuZ6ei
value 2235142000
address 16dWiQDaADCuKuvrXLJGRY7ZRLZt9L6SSE